The rich snow no bounds<br />

Ski Independence has lifted the lid on<br />

luxury skiing, revealing how the rich<br />

and famous can spend £56,000 on the<br />

slopes in just seven days at Courchevel<br />

1850 - the favoured destination for David<br />

and Victoria Beckham and the Duke and<br />

Duchess of Cambridge.<br />

A sample holiday itinerary includes: A<br />

£25,000 seven-night stay at the five-star<br />

Hotel L’Apogée, caviar facials at the inhotel<br />

spa and a £12,000 shopping spree.<br />

There's also an adrenaline-inducing<br />

activities package including helicopter<br />

trips and sledding, worth over £12,000,<br />

on-demand limousine services and<br />

helicopter taxis. Guests don’t have to lift<br />

a finger, and hotel staff even offer to help<br />

place their ski boots on.<br />

Tap happy<br />

<strong>Travel</strong> booking site Globehunters has<br />

revealed a list of countries where you<br />

can’t drink tap water and it's not short -<br />

there are 187! You'll need to go bottled<br />

everywhere in Africa, Asia - except Japan<br />

and South Korea - and Latin America -<br />

bar Chile and Costa Rica. Surprising bad<br />

water spots are Cyprus, the Maldives<br />

and Fiji - but that pricy Fiji Water is ok!<br />

Champagne is so 2018<br />

Who needs Europe anyway? Well...<br />

at least we don't need to rely on<br />

Champagne to christen our ships!<br />

Saga's new vessel Spirit of Discovery<br />

is to be christened with a Jeroboam<br />

(four bottles in one) of its very ownlabel<br />

English sparkling wine instead of<br />

the usual French sparkling stuff, at her<br />

christening in the Port of Dover on July<br />

5 this year. It will also be served on<br />

board the ship. saga.co.uk<br />

Top Euro foods<br />

WeSwap unveiled the top destinations for<br />

consumers to enjoy European delicacies ahead<br />

of our (maybe) impending exit from the EU.<br />

But don't worry, whatever happens, these<br />

delicious dishes will still be there to taste.<br />

1 Waffles in Belgium<br />

2 Kremrole In Czech Republic<br />

3 Arancini in Italy<br />

4 Pierogi in Poland<br />

5 Goulash in Hungary<br />

6 Currywurst in Germany<br />

7 Moussaka in Greece<br />

8 Halloumi in Cyprus<br />

9 Köttbullar in<br />

Sweden<br />

10 Potica in<br />

Slovenia<br />
